Description

This book documents the emergence of a spectacular and innovative office building in Vienna.

The striking T-center St. Marx Vienna was designed and built by the architects, Gnther Domenig, Hermann Eisenkck and Herfried Peyker. Recently completed, the project has 119, 000 metre squared of usable floor space and contains offices for 3000 employees. Unusually proportioned, the building can be described as a reclining sculpture 60m high and 255m long with a 40m wing cantilevering out. From a town-planning perspective, this building represents the first step in the development of a new district on the site of the former St. Marx abattoir and cattle sheds. This book documents the design and building process of this spectacular building illustrated with a large number of detailed drawings and photos of the construction itself.
